SegWit (Segregated Witness) là một cải tiến cơ bản trong kiến trúc của Bitcoin, nhằm giải quyết các vấn đề về mở rộng quy mô và lỗ hổng của mạng. Đổi mới này đã biến đổi căn bản cách mà mạng xử lý và xác minh các giao dịch.
Cơ chế hoạt động của SegWit: nó thực sự được thiết lập như thế nào
Cơ sở của SegWit là một ý tưởng đơn giản nhưng mạnh mẽ: phân chia cấu trúc giao dịch thành hai thành phần. Phần đầu tiên chứa thông tin về việc chuyển tiền, phần thứ hai bao gồm chữ ký mật mã, khóa công khai và các siêu dữ liệu xác thực khác.
Điều khác biệt chính là dữ liệu chữ ký ( được gọi là “nhân chứng” ) được tách biệt về mặt vật lý khỏi thân chính của giao dịch. Điều này cho phép hệ thống loại bỏ chúng khỏi việc tính toán kích thước khối. Nhờ cách tiếp cận này, dung lượng của một khối đã hiệu quả tăng từ 1 MB lên khoảng 4 MB, mặc dù giới hạn nominal vẫn giữ nguyên.
Lịch sử triển khai và tiến hóa
Khái niệm được phát triển vào năm 2015 bởi nhà phát triển Peter Willem cùng với đội ngũ Bitcoin Core. Sau hai năm thử nghiệm và thảo luận trong cộng đồng, bản cập nhật đã được triển khai dưới dạng soft fork vào tháng 8 năm 2017. Điều này có nghĩa là sự thay đổi tương thích ngược với các phiên bản phần mềm cũ.
Tác động thực tiễn đến mạng
Không có việc triển khai giao thức này, chữ ký số có thể chiếm tới 65% dung lượng khối, tạo ra một nút thắt nghiêm trọng cho băng thông. SegWit đã giải quyết vấn đề này một cách triệt để: nhờ vào việc phân bổ lại dữ liệu, mạng lưới đã có khả năng chứa đựng một số lượng giao dịch lớn hơn đáng kể trong một khoảng thời gian.
Kết quả thật ấn tượng: băng thông mạng đã tăng rõ rệt, tốc độ xử lý đã được tăng tốc, và chỉ số TPS ( giao dịch mỗi giây ) đã thể hiện sự gia tăng rõ ràng. Hơn nữa, việc tách chữ ký đã loại bỏ lỗ hổng được biết đến như là vấn đề tính dẻo của giao dịch, khi mà kẻ xấu có thể sửa đổi các định danh thanh toán trước khi chúng được xác nhận cuối cùng.
Lỗ hổng này là rất nghiêm trọng đối với sự phát triển của các giải pháp phi tập trung lớp hai, chẳng hạn như Lightning Network, những thứ yêu cầu sự ổn định tuyệt đối của các định danh giao dịch.
Cuộc tranh luận trong cộng đồng tiền điện tử
Việc triển khai SegWit không diễn ra suôn sẻ. Trong hệ sinh thái Bitcoin, đã diễn ra một cuộc thảo luận căng thẳng về tính khả thi và an toàn của cách tiếp cận này. Những bất đồng đã sâu sắc đến mức dẫn đến sự chia rẽ trong cộng đồng và việc tạo ra Bitcoin Cash - một nhánh của Bitcoin, đã đi theo con đường thay thế mở rộng kích thước khối mà không áp dụng Segregated Witness.
Các nhà phê bình SegWit đã chỉ ra những rủi ro tiềm ẩn: độ khó trong việc triển khai, khả năng có lỗ hổng trong kiến trúc mới và nguy cơ lý thuyết rằng một số giao dịch có thể bị chi tiêu bởi các bên không được ủy quyền. Bất chấp sự hoài nghi, phần lớn mạng lưới đã ủng hộ bản cập nhật, và nó vẫn hoạt động thành công cho đến ngày nay.
Trang này có thể chứa nội dung của bên thứ ba, được cung cấp chỉ nhằm mục đích thông tin (không phải là tuyên bố/bảo đảm) và không được coi là sự chứng thực cho quan điểm của Gate hoặc là lời khuyên về tài chính hoặc chuyên môn. Xem Tuyên bố từ chối trách nhiệm để biết chi tiết.
SegWit: Đây là gì và nó đã thay đổi Bitcoин như thế nào
SegWit (Segregated Witness) là một cải tiến cơ bản trong kiến trúc của Bitcoin, nhằm giải quyết các vấn đề về mở rộng quy mô và lỗ hổng của mạng. Đổi mới này đã biến đổi căn bản cách mà mạng xử lý và xác minh các giao dịch.
Cơ chế hoạt động của SegWit: nó thực sự được thiết lập như thế nào
Cơ sở của SegWit là một ý tưởng đơn giản nhưng mạnh mẽ: phân chia cấu trúc giao dịch thành hai thành phần. Phần đầu tiên chứa thông tin về việc chuyển tiền, phần thứ hai bao gồm chữ ký mật mã, khóa công khai và các siêu dữ liệu xác thực khác.
Điều khác biệt chính là dữ liệu chữ ký ( được gọi là “nhân chứng” ) được tách biệt về mặt vật lý khỏi thân chính của giao dịch. Điều này cho phép hệ thống loại bỏ chúng khỏi việc tính toán kích thước khối. Nhờ cách tiếp cận này, dung lượng của một khối đã hiệu quả tăng từ 1 MB lên khoảng 4 MB, mặc dù giới hạn nominal vẫn giữ nguyên.
Lịch sử triển khai và tiến hóa
Khái niệm được phát triển vào năm 2015 bởi nhà phát triển Peter Willem cùng với đội ngũ Bitcoin Core. Sau hai năm thử nghiệm và thảo luận trong cộng đồng, bản cập nhật đã được triển khai dưới dạng soft fork vào tháng 8 năm 2017. Điều này có nghĩa là sự thay đổi tương thích ngược với các phiên bản phần mềm cũ.
Tác động thực tiễn đến mạng
Không có việc triển khai giao thức này, chữ ký số có thể chiếm tới 65% dung lượng khối, tạo ra một nút thắt nghiêm trọng cho băng thông. SegWit đã giải quyết vấn đề này một cách triệt để: nhờ vào việc phân bổ lại dữ liệu, mạng lưới đã có khả năng chứa đựng một số lượng giao dịch lớn hơn đáng kể trong một khoảng thời gian.
Kết quả thật ấn tượng: băng thông mạng đã tăng rõ rệt, tốc độ xử lý đã được tăng tốc, và chỉ số TPS ( giao dịch mỗi giây ) đã thể hiện sự gia tăng rõ ràng. Hơn nữa, việc tách chữ ký đã loại bỏ lỗ hổng được biết đến như là vấn đề tính dẻo của giao dịch, khi mà kẻ xấu có thể sửa đổi các định danh thanh toán trước khi chúng được xác nhận cuối cùng.
Lỗ hổng này là rất nghiêm trọng đối với sự phát triển của các giải pháp phi tập trung lớp hai, chẳng hạn như Lightning Network, những thứ yêu cầu sự ổn định tuyệt đối của các định danh giao dịch.
Cuộc tranh luận trong cộng đồng tiền điện tử
Việc triển khai SegWit không diễn ra suôn sẻ. Trong hệ sinh thái Bitcoin, đã diễn ra một cuộc thảo luận căng thẳng về tính khả thi và an toàn của cách tiếp cận này. Những bất đồng đã sâu sắc đến mức dẫn đến sự chia rẽ trong cộng đồng và việc tạo ra Bitcoin Cash - một nhánh của Bitcoin, đã đi theo con đường thay thế mở rộng kích thước khối mà không áp dụng Segregated Witness.
Các nhà phê bình SegWit đã chỉ ra những rủi ro tiềm ẩn: độ khó trong việc triển khai, khả năng có lỗ hổng trong kiến trúc mới và nguy cơ lý thuyết rằng một số giao dịch có thể bị chi tiêu bởi các bên không được ủy quyền. Bất chấp sự hoài nghi, phần lớn mạng lưới đã ủng hộ bản cập nhật, và nó vẫn hoạt động thành công cho đến ngày nay.